There are a number of HR compliance-related deadlines that affect many employers. Mark the following requirements on your calendar for 2007 and future years. New Hampshire Safety Summary Form
- Requirement: 10 or more employees working in NH
- DEADLINE: Biennial submission due before January 1st of the following year
- The instructions for Form 5500 provides details on which plans are required to file Form 5500 and how to complete it
- The Department of Labor has also published a Troubleshooter's Guide to Filing the ERISA Annual Report (Form 5500)
- Assistance may also be obtained from an experienced benefits attorney or accountant
- DEADLINE: file annually by the last day of the 7th month following the end of the plan year (July 31st for calendar year plans)
- All employers
- Maintain calendar year record of all reportable injuries and illnesses incurred during the year
- Use information to prepare OSHA 300A
- Post in a conspicuous location i.e., lunchroom
- Ensure employee’s confidential information is maintained
- DEADLINE: post February 1st – April 30th each year
